Creating Heatmaps (QGIS3) ¶. Heatmaps are one of the best visualization tools for dense point data. Heatmap is an interpolation technique that useful in determining density of input features. Heatmaps are most commonly used to visualize crime data, traffic incidents, housing density etc. QGIS has a heatmap renderer that can be used to style a ...A heat map data visualization, specifically a geographic heat map, shows data distribution by color or shading, and sometimes by using two-dimensional topographic elements. A heat map represents the geographic density of features on a map. Colored areas represent these points, which is useful for layers with a large number of features. To create a heat map in ArcMap, create a layer with features before using tools in either the Density toolset of the Spatial Analyst toolbox or the Mapping Clusters toolset of ... Performance D, % Sector. x1. −3% −2% −1% 0% 1% 2% 3% Get the detailed view of the world stocks included into …, A risk heat map is a powerful visualization tool for Enterprise Risk Management. Also known as a risk heat chart or risk matrix, it shows risk likelihood on the horizontal axis (X) and risk impact on the vertical axis (Y). Now I want to use python to generate a heat map like the picture shown …, Click maps; Attention maps; Scroll maps. To make accurate inferencesfor any of the above heat-map types, you should have enough of a sample size per page/screen before you act on results. A good rule of thumb is 2,000–3,000 pageviews per design screen,and also per device (i.e. look at mobile and desktop separately)., A heat map (or heatmap) is a 2-dimensional data visualization technique that represents the magnitude of individual values within a dataset as a color. Our …, Heatmapper allows users to generate, cluster and visualize: 1) expression-based heat maps from transcriptomic, proteomic and metabolomic experiments; 2) pairwise …, Scale heatmap. pheatmap provides a parameter scale to rescale the default values in column or row direction. The rescaling is useful when the values in the dataset are very different from each other.
